Cosplayer of the week : Lauren Edinger AKA WeyrWoman Cosplay

Leo Nocedo : How did you discover cosplaying?

Lauren Edinger : My dad introduced me to cons at a young age! I’ve been making my costumes since I was a kid.

Leo Nocedo :What was your first cosplay?

Lauren Edinger : Adult cosplay Princess Leia. Kid cosplay…I think a cat of some sort? Haha

Leo Nocedo : What are your next 3 cosplay plans?

Lauren Edinger :  Taarna, Aurora…ummm no idea.

Leo Nocedo : Have you ever been in a cosplay contest?

Lauren Edinger : Once at a comic shop and once at a con (but it was a bad experience)

Leo Nocedo : Do you prefer sewing, armor making, or wig working?

Lauren Edinger : Sewing and armor (though I’m new at armor)

Leo Nocedo : Do you prefer to do photoshoots at cons or at specific locations?

Lauren Edinger : Locations!

Leo Nocedo : Is there a type of character you cosplay frequently?

Lauren Edinger : Disney princesses and variations!

Leo Nocedo :Do you have any favorite cosplayers?

Lauren Edinger : Too many to name. I’m a big fan of my @thegothamundergroundcosplay group and the cosplayers in it though!

Leo Nocedo :What’s the most detailed cosplay you’ve ever done?

Lauren Edinger : Maleficent or my Sorsha

Leo Nocedo :What are your top 3 craftsmanship tips?

Lauren Edinger : Do not guesstimate measurements, don’t be afraid to experiment, there are so many YouTube tutorials!!!!

Leo Nocedo : What is your favorite cosplay you’ve done?

Lauren Edinger : Maleficent

Leo Nocedo : What is your worst cosplay “horror” story?

Lauren Edinger : Ummmm… my costume ripped on stage…

Leo Nocedo : What’s your funniest cosplay story?

Lauren Edinger : Probably the same as the worst lmfao just not at the time!!

Leo Nocedo : What’s the best in-character interaction you’ve ever had?

Lauren Edinger : Children’s hospitals. There was a little girl who was just sure I was the real rapunzel, it was amazing.

Leo Nocedo is a cosplay photographer who has been using a camera for the last forty years in many forms , in the military and professional studios in Miami and New York city . He got his start in cosplay photography attending conventions with his brother Juan Nocedo . He keeps on doing what he does to honor his late brother .
